π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

9 items
  • 4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2.5 teaspoons instant yeast
  • 1 cup coconut milk
  • 0.5 cup pineapple juice
  • 0.5 cup cane sugar
  • 0.25 cup vegan butter, melted
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on turmeric powder

πŸ“ Instructions

12 steps
1

In a saucepan, warm the coconut milk and pineapple juice over low heat until just warm (about 110Β°F or 43Β°C), then remove from heat.

2

In a large mixing bowl, combine the warm coconut milk and pineapple juice with the yeast and 1 tablespoon of the sugar. Stir and let it sit for 5 minutes until foamy.

3

Add the remaining sugar, melted vegan butter, vanilla extract, salt, and turmeric to the yeast mixture, stirring to combine.

4

Gradually add the flour, 1 cup at a time, stirring with a wooden spoon until a dough begins to form.

5

Transfer the dough to a lightly floured surface and knead for 8-10 minutes until smooth and elastic.

6

Place the dough in a lightly oiled bowl, cover with a clean kitchen towel, and let it rise in a warm area for about 1 hour or until doubled in size.

7

After the dough has risen, punch it down to release the air and divide it into 12 equal pieces.

8

Shape each piece into a ball and place them in a greased 9x13-inch baking dish.

9

Cover the rolls with a kitchen towel and let them rise again for 30 minutes until puffy.

10

Preheat the oven to 350Β°F (175Β°C).

11

Bake the rolls in the preheated oven for 20 minutes or until golden brown.

12

Remove the rolls from the oven and let them cool slightly before serving. Enjoy the sweet and fluffy goodness!
